New Look uses the Xbox Kinect to create their new video

New Look the band, not the high street shop, are Brooklyn based musicians who have just commissioned directing duo Tim & Joe to create the video for their latest single Nap on the bow.

The directors have used the Xbox Kinect to record the bands movement which gives an incredible 3D effect.  The introduction of the Kinect to the market has meant that this high-tech equipment is available to the masses making it possible for hackers to break the system and reap the benefits of such technology for creative purposes. Rome Experiments with Chrome Experiments

Chris Milk is already famed for directing The Wilderness Downtown which was a HTML5 and Chrome Experiment music video for Arcade Fire’s song ‘We used to wait’ from The Suburbs album.

His most recent work has been with world renowned Hip Hop artist and producer Danger Mouse who has, of late, been working on his new project band Rome with Jack White, Nora Jones and Daniele Luppi.

The Vaccines use instagram and crowdsourcing to create their new music video

Instagram, the app which allows you to share sepia-hued photos instantly, currently has has around 10 million users with over 250 million photos shared so there’s plenty of material to crowdsource your video from.
